  NPVR Web Radio
Posted by: mvallevand - 2010-06-14, 04:54 AM - Forum: Community Announcements - Replies (5)

I am pleased to announce a new version of the Web Radio plugin with NPVR Support. Since NPVR no longer has Net Radio, I though that is important to simplify Web Radio so more of you can enjoy it, hopefully you will agree. Here are some new features

- improved installer
- more meaningful error messages
- native playback of mp3 files (no external player required)
- direct support for several NMTs and MVP running together
- basic install provides Net Radio's Shoutcast listings, plus they are not limited to 25 stations and they show "now playing art"

The basic installer is here http://gbpvr.com/pmwiki/uploads/Plugin/NWebRadio.zip It's only about 310K

In addition for those that have only used Net Radio, you are missing out on a lot of music. The Web Radio Add On file http://gbpvr.com/pmwiki/uploads/Plugin/N...AddOns.zip 4.5 MB is worth a look. In this new version I have added itunes-style Podcast support to the many listing shown on the screen shot. Again the native player will be used for mp3 files, and vlc is used behind the scenes to playback other stream types.

Please post your support questions on the support forum http://forums.gbpvr.com//forumdisplay.ph...-streaming

Thanks to Jaggy for the help skinning this, to sub for helping figure out NPVR and for adding some plugin support this needed, and to the beta testers from help and feedback

Martin

  N-PVR skin Blue-Retro-VE
Posted by: Jaggy - 2010-06-14, 12:02 AM - Forum: Community Announcements - Replies (9)

Updated version 1.4 30-June-2010 attached with a name change to BlueRetroVE (note existing users will also have to select the new name in Settings after updating to use the new version skin) There have been quite a few mostly minor changes including the new additions from NPVR 1.5.21

It will install into "..\your data directory\NPVR\Skin\BlueRetroVE" you will have to select it under Settings->General "Active skin" to see it in action.

To get channel logos working you have to put the logos into ..\your data directory\NPVR\Media\Channels & they need to have the same name as your channels.

This version has had a lot more testing & my No.1 Beta tester says it is at full release stage & I feel it is now close to but not quite out of beta stage yet, but still let me know of any bugs you see, or changes you would like made.
